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/5] std::latch: reduce internal implementation from ptrdiff_t to int

On Friday, 26 February 2021 11:31:00 PST Andreas Schwab wrote:
> On Feb 26 2021, Thiago Macieira wrote:
> > On Friday, 26 February 2021 10:14:42 PST Andreas Schwab wrote:
> >> On Feb 26 2021, Thiago Macieira via Gcc-patches wrote:
> >> > - alignas(__alignof__(ptrdiff_t)) ptrdiff_t _M_a;
> >> > + alignas(__alignof__(int)) int _M_a;
> >>
> >> Futexes must be aligned to 4 bytes.
> >
> > Agreed, but doesn't this accomplish that?
>
> No. It uses whatever alignment the type already has, and is an
> elaborate no-op.
I thought so too when I read the original line. But I expected it was written
like that for a reason, especially since the same pattern appears in other
places.
I can change to "alignas(4)" (which is a GCC extension, I believe). Is that
the correct solution?
